Webtables in this guide for withholding starting with the first payroll in January 2024. For 2024, employers can use a Federal Basic Personal Amount (BPAF) of $14,398 for all employees. The federal income tax thresholds have been indexed for 2024. The federal Canada Employment Amount has been indexed to $1,287 for 2024. WebJan 6, 2024 · The 2024 federal brackets are: zero to $50,197 of income (15 per cent); more than $50,197 to $100,392 (20.5 per cent); above $100,392 to $155,625 (26 per cent); over $155,625 to $221,708 (29 per cent); and anything above that is taxed at 33 per cent. WebDec 30, 2024 · The employee and employer CPP contribution rates will increase to 5.95 per cent in 2024 from 5.70 per cent in 2024, the Canada Revenue Agency announced in November. WebCRA Payroll Updates typically come out twice annually – generally in January and then July – however, updates are possible at other times. It is important to ensure your updates are installed and applied correctly, as it is difficult & cumbersome to …
